A mass spectrometer to analyze trace-level elements

The Spectrogreen MS quadrupole mass spectrometer (photo) is engineered for high-performance, routine trace-level elemental analysis and ease of use. It addresses the needs of laboratories handling environmental, pharmaceutical, food, consumer product testing and industrial applications. Equipped with a high-matrix interface, efficient collision/reaction cell technology and a state-of-the-art quadrupole analyzer, the Spectrogreen MS ensures excellent sensitivity, stability and interference control — even for complex matrices. It easily meets regulatory standards, and its Quadrupole Digital Sequencer lets many users with diverse samples analyze both high-concentration and trace isotopes in a single measurement. — Spectro Analytical Instruments, Kleve, Germany
